Expertise That Saves Time and Money
A common misconception is that hiring a landscape architect adds unnecessary cost. In reality, professional design reduces expenses in the long run. Architects understand how to optimize your budget by selecting the right materials, plant species, and layout for the climate and soil. Their training helps avoid costly mistakes such as improper grading, drainage issues, or plant selection errors that lead to premature replacements. Instead of spending years correcting problems, you begin with a plan that works efficiently from day one. Moreover, landscape architects coordinate with contractors, engineers, and city planners, ensuring every permit, regulation, and safety requirement is properly addressed. This streamlines the entire process and eliminates the headaches of managing multiple vendors or redesigning plans mid-project.
Enhancing Sustainability and Environmental Health
Sustainability is at the heart of modern landscape architecture. Professionals prioritize eco-friendly practices—like rainwater harvesting, native plant selection, and soil conservation—that reduce maintenance costs and environmental impact. They design irrigation systems that minimize water waste and use strategic grading to prevent erosion. These environmentally conscious designs benefit not only your property but also the surrounding ecosystem. A landscape that incorporates native species, for example, attracts pollinators and improves biodiversity. The result is a living space that supports both human enjoyment and environmental balance.
